Default A Week Ago... (Graphs, PT, etc.)

One week ago I was taking a couple days off from poker. I was playing 100nl and had a few thousand dollars online, but was getting into kind of heavy debt in real life with a lot of expenses I still needed to take care of after moving. I was feeling kind of down, and knew I was going to actually have to put in some real hours this month so I could make some money; none of this 10-15 hours/week [censored].

But before that, I was set on taking a break and getting regrouped before my long grind. The break started on Sunday afternoon, and finally on Friday I decided to play a couple HU donk n go's just for fun. I hadn't taken more than 1-2 days off from playing any poker in a pretty long while (lol addiction?), and I actually missed it. This was the first time I'd actually played poker for fun in ages, and it was nice.

The next night, Saturday, I again decided to play just for the fun of it. So I made some dinner, started watching a movie, and registered for the first decent MTT that was starting. That turned out to be a 50r on FTP.

So I 1-tabled a donkament while watching a movie and, somehow, 5 hours later I had won it for $5400.

Now, that's obviously not anything even BBV-worthy, but for a 100nl player in money trouble, it was pretty [censored] nice. Especially since 2007 has not been kind to me when it comes to donkaments. The 3 major FTs I had made over the last few months all ended in standard jokeament fashion with me finishing like 6th to 9th in all of them.

So, needless to say, I was excited.

Winning that money was going to open doors for me. I could pay off my debt, take a trip, and move back to 200nl. Good times were on the horizon.

But little did I know how good and how soon I would be rewarded.

Sunday morning I decided to start back with 200nl, here are the results since, including shots at 400nl and 600nl:







From Saturday to Wednesday:

5 hours of MTT + 4 hours of cash = 9 hours

$5400 from MTT + $4500 from cash = $9900

Not too [censored] shabby for someone who was ready to grind their ass off at 100nl for a month.
